My son can walk but not huge distances and so we currently use a Maclaren Major. He is getting bigger and we need to start thinking about the next chair for him and don't want to get a wheelchair. Just wondering if anyone has experiences with any pushchairs for older children ?

    Hi Natster, Your local wheelchair services should be able to provide advice (they should also be able to advise re "older kid pushchairs"). In Scotland you can phone for advice - perhaps your health visitor can advice how to contact them in your area.

    how old is your child?

    some people use the specialneeds three wheelers which go to large sizes eg http://www.specialneedspushchairs.co.uk/babyjogger_independence.htm (5 to 10 years, with a maximum weight limit of 100lbs (45kg). )

    but others say that using a wheelchair stops the young person being treated like a baby and makes them more "grown up"

    they also doa freedom model "Designed for the older child/young adult 10 years plus with a maximum weight limit of 200lbs (90kg). "
